  1. Develop and implement safety protocols and procedures to ensure compliance with industry regulations and standards.
  2. Conduct regular safety audits and inspections to identify potential hazards and risks and make recommendations for improvement.
  3. Collaborate with management and employees to promote a culture of safety and increase safety awareness.
  4. Train and educate employees on safety procedures and protocols to ensure understanding and compliance.
  5. Investigate and report on safety incidents and accidents, identifying root causes and implementing corrective actions.
  6. Stay up-to-date on industry regulations and best practices to continuously improve safety standards.
  7. Develop and maintain safety records and reports, ensuring accuracy and completeness.
  8. Conduct safety meetings and provide guidance and support to management and employees on safety-related matters.
  9. Monitor and evaluate safety performance and make recommendations for improvement.
  10. Proactively identify potential safety issues and work with relevant stakeholders to address and resolve them.
  11. Serve as a point of contact for safety-related inquiries and concerns from employees and management.
  12. Collaborate with other departments and teams to ensure a cohesive and consistent approach to safety across the organization.
  13. Participate in safety committees and represent the company in safety-related meetings and events.
  14. Assist in the development and implementation of emergency response plans.
  15. Continuously assess and improve safety programs and initiatives to ensure their effectiveness.

About Union Pacific Railroad

The Union Pacific Railroad, legally Union Pacific Railroad Company and simply Union Pacific, is a freight-hauling railroad that operates 8,300 locomotives over 32,200 miles routes in 23 U.S. states west of Chicago and New Orleans.
